We Lost A Visionary Leader, Hon Ogah Mourns Ohanaeze Ndigbo PG, Iwuanyanwu

Hon Amobi Godwin Ogah, member representing Isuikwuato/Umunneochi Federal Constituency, has announced the passing of Chief Emmanuel Iwuanyanwu, President-General of Ohanaeze Ndigbo Worldwide, with a heavy heart.

Chief Iwuanyanwu’s sudden demise has sent shockwaves throughout Nigeria, leaving a monumental void in the Igbo nation. He was a champion of peace, unity, and development, dedicating his life to the advancement of the Igbo people.

Hon Ogah, who had the privilege of working with Chief Iwuanyanwu, praised his unwavering commitment to the welfare of Ndigbo. “His leadership and wisdom will be deeply missed, but his legacy will continue to inspire us to strive for greatness,” he said.

On behalf of his constituents and the people of Abia State, Hon Ogah extended heartfelt condolences to the family of Chief Iwuanyanwu, Ohanaeze Ndigbo Worldwide, and the entire Igbo nation.
